Location: San Antonio, TX The Battle of the Alamo, fought from February 23 to March 6, 1836, was a pivotal moment in the Texas Revolution. A small band of Texian defenders, including William B. Travis, James Bowie, and Davy Crockett, held out for 13 days against General Santa Anna’s vastly larger Mexican army. Though the Alamo fell and all defenders were killed, their sacrifice became a rallying cry—“Remember the Alamo!”—inspiring Texians to victory later at the Battle of San Jacinto, securing Texas independence.
